How to Create a Checklist for Your Yard Sale Preparation

A yard sale can be an exciting opportunity to declutter your home while making some extra cash. However, the process of organizing and executing a successful yard sale can be overwhelming without proper planning. A well-structured checklist is essential for ensuring that every aspect of your yard sale preparation runs smoothly. This comprehensive guide will walk you through creating a detailed checklist that encompasses all stages of your yard sale preparation, from initial planning to post-sale tasks.

Setting Goals for Your Yard Sale

Before diving into the nitty-gritty of preparation, it's important to set clear goals for your yard sale. Consider the following:

2.1 Financial Objectives

Determine how much money you hope to make from the sale. Setting a financial target can help motivate you to price items appropriately and promote effectively.

2.2 Inventory Goals

Evaluate how many items you'd like to sell. Decluttering may not only be about making money but also about clearing space in your home.

2.3 Community Engagement

Consider your yard sale as a way to connect with your community. Think about how you can make the event enjoyable for neighbors and potential buyers.

Preliminary Planning

3.1 Choosing a Date and Time

Selecting the right date and time is crucial for maximizing attendance.

Checklist:

  • Research Local Events : Avoid scheduling conflicts with local festivals or holidays.
  • Choose a Weekend : Saturdays are typically the best days for yard sales.
  • Set the Time : Aim for early morning hours (7 AM to 11 AM) when foot traffic is higher.

3.2 Gathering Supplies

Having the right supplies on hand ensures that you are prepared for the day of the sale.

Checklist:

  • Tables for displaying items
  • Blankets or tarps for ground-level displays
  • Pricing stickers or tags
  • Cash box or pouch
  • Bags for customers
  • Signage materials (poster board, markers)
  • Refreshments (optional)

Sorting and Organizing Items

4.1 Decluttering

Start by going through your belongings and identifying items to sell.

Checklist:

  • Room-by-Room Assessment : Go through each room systematically.
  • Decision-Making Process : Ask yourself if you've used the item in the last year. If not, consider selling it.
  • Separate Keep, Sell, Donate Piles: Sort items into three categories: keep, sell, and donate.

4.2 Categorizing Items

Once you've identified what to sell, organize your items into categories for easy display.

Checklist:

  • Clothing
  • Home goods
  • Toys and games
  • Electronics
  • Furniture
  • Books

Pricing Your Items

Proper pricing can significantly impact your sales.

Checklist:

  • Research Similar Items : Check online marketplaces to gauge pricing for similar items.
  • Use Simple Pricing Strategies : Consider using whole numbers or quarter increments for easy transactions.
  • Bundle Deals : Offer discounts for buying multiple items (e.g., "Buy two, get one free").
  • Label Clearly : Ensure all items have visible price tags.

Marketing Your Yard Sale

Effective marketing attracts more customers and increases the likelihood of sales.

6.1 Creating Advertisements

Develop advertising materials that will capture attention.

Checklist:

  • Design flyers with clear details (date, time, location).
  • Include appealing visuals of unique items.
  • Distribute flyers in your neighborhood and local establishments.

6.2 Utilizing Social Media

Leverage social media platforms to spread the word about your yard sale.

Checklist:

  • Create an event page on Facebook or use platforms like Nextdoor.
  • Post regularly leading up to the sale, sharing sneak peeks of items.
  • Encourage friends and family to share your posts.

Setting Up the Day Before

7.1 Organizing Your Space

Preparation the day before allows you to set up efficiently.

Checklist:

  • Identify the area where you'll host the sale.
  • Set up tables and displays in advance.
  • Organize items by category and ensure they are clean and presentable.

7.2 Preparing Signs

Good signage directs traffic to your sale and communicates important information.

Checklist:

  • Create eye-catching signs with bright colors.
  • Include arrows and clear messaging (e.g., "Yard Sale -- This Way!").
  • Place signs strategically around your neighborhood.

Executing the Sale

8.1 Customer Engagement

Engaging with customers enhances their shopping experience.

Checklist:

  • Greet everyone who arrives with a friendly demeanor.
  • Offer assistance if someone seems interested in a particular item.
  • Be approachable and open to negotiations.

8.2 Managing Transactions

A smooth transaction process ensures a positive experience for both you and your customers.

Checklist:

  • Prepare a cash box with small bills and coins.
  • Have a mobile payment option available (e.g., PayPal, Venmo).
  • Keep a record of sales if desired for tracking.

Post-Sale Cleanup and Reflection

Once the sale is over, take time to clean up and reflect on the experience.

Checklist:

  • Organize Remaining Items: Decide what to do with unsold items (donate, store, or list online).
  • Thank Helpers : If friends or family helped, express gratitude.
  • Reflect on Experiences : Assess what went well and what could improve for future sales.
  • Document Insights : Write down lessons learned for future reference.
